About

Roberto Sanchís is a scholar working on Control and Systems Engineering, Computer Networks and Communications and Electrical and Electronic Engineering. According to data from OpenAlex, Roberto Sanchís has authored 65 papers receiving a total of 501 indexed citations (citations by other indexed papers that have themselves been cited), including 61 papers in Control and Systems Engineering, 6 papers in Computer Networks and Communications and 5 papers in Electrical and Electronic Engineering. Recurrent topics in Roberto Sanchís's work include Advanced Control Systems Optimization (35 papers), Fault Detection and Control Systems (31 papers) and Control Systems and Identification (24 papers). Roberto Sanchís is often cited by papers focused on Advanced Control Systems Optimization (35 papers), Fault Detection and Control Systems (31 papers) and Control Systems and Identification (24 papers). Roberto Sanchís collaborates with scholars based in Spain, Australia and Netherlands. Roberto Sanchís's co-authors include Pedro Albertos, Ignacio Peñarrocha, Antonio Sala, Henk Nijmeijer, J.L. Muñoz-Cobo, Cláubia Pereira, G. Verdú, Daniel E. Quevedo, David Tena and D. Ginestar and has published in prestigious journals such as Automatica, IEEE Transactions on Signal Processing and Journal of the Franklin Institute.
